§ 14-164. Issuance.  


Latest version.
  • When the electrical inspector finds the application to be correct, and the plans and diagram or specifications are approved and the required fees have been paid, he shall cause the permit to be issued. Upon receipt of such permit, the electrician may start the proposed job and make the installation described in his application, requesting inspection by the inspector in the proper sequence as the work progresses.

(Code 1974, § 4-20.4(g); Code 1994, § 14-126; Code 2005, § 14-164)
